Bio
2019 (Senior)
Started and appeared in all 19 games for Indiana this season… part of backline that posted six Big Ten shutouts, a new program record… shutout nine opponents this season, tied for most in program history… fired off a season-high two shots at UT Martin (9/12) and Rutgers (11/3)… took a shot at Murray State (8/30) and against Purdue (10/27)… assisted on the game-winner at Michigan State to close out the season on Oct. 30.
2018 (Junior)
• Big Ten Distinguished Scholar
• Academic All-Big Ten
Started 16 games, primarily as an outside back but also seeing time at centerback … scored a goal and added three assists … assisted on Allison Jorden’s goal against Kentucky on Sept. 7 … scored an 84th minute equalizer against Minnesota on Oct. 7 as IU would go on to win the game, 3-2 … also added an assist against the Golden Gophers … assisted on Mykayla Brown’s goal against No. 21 Penn State on Oct. 18
2017 (Sophomore)
• Big Ten Preseason Honors List
• Academic All-Big Ten
Started all 19 games on the backline … in the season opener, scored her first career goal and added an assist in Indiana’ 3-1 victory against Cal Poly … found the back of the net at North Texas on Sept. 10 as the Hoosiers drew with Mean Green, 3-3 … assisted on Maya Piper’s gamewinner at No. 23 SMU on Sept. 8 … put up eight shots with six being on-target … named Academic All-Big Ten.
2016 (Freshman)
Started all 20 games for the Hoosiers as a defender … played all but 43 minutes over the course of the season … tallied seven assists in 2016, tied for seventh-most in a single season at IU … her four assists in conference action is tied for the second-most in a single year in program history and puts her tied for fifth-most in an IU career in Big Ten play … her seven points was second on the team … picked up one assist in four of the last five games of the season … earned assists in Indiana’s wins against Northern Colorado (Aug. 28), James Madison (Sept. 11), Wisconsin (Sept. 25), Ohio State (Oct. 13) and Maryland (Oct. 16) … also earned an assist against Michigan (Oct. 26) and against Minnesota in the Big Ten Tournament (Oct. 30) … put up six shots, with three being on goal.
Prep/Personal
Played club for FC London Women’s League 1 and the Burlington Bayhawks with fellow Hoosier Chandra Davidson … led Burlington to 2015 OYSL Championship and 2014 Ontario Cup Championship … member of Team Ontario from 2012-14 and twice served as team captain … guided team to 2013 National All-Star Championship … earned 2014 Athlete of the Year honors at John Paul II Catholic School after leading team to a 2014 City Championship and WOSAA Finalist finish … named to the 2016 League1 Ontario All-Star Game roster ... also ran cross country and played volleyball and basketball … father is Rob … has two siblings, Jordan and Jared ... majoring in Exercise Science.
